Output 6d8c50246284d203e0705a23a3396cca5f516b8673d55cb222f09e89f59594e8:1

value
741200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42505b270141b5df96d4897add65ae66aa46638c OP_EQUAL
address
DBBjQA2YiR2XGcYiAC1stWJoTmMJGMXxEE
transaction
6d8c50246284d203e0705a23a3396cca5f516b8673d55cb222f09e89f59594e8
spent
true